Originally Posted by Sonic Boom
I have had to pull all the plugs of the ABS unit under the brake fluid reservoir to make my new T66 and Tubular manifold fit.
Will the brakes still work as normal just without the abs being functional?
Before you ask I can't just take it out for a spin as i'm having a custom exhaust made.
Cheers Rich
Are you using rwd or a 4x4 reservoir & pump. The 4x4 moves the reserviour to the left hand side of the pump (looking from front) it frees up loads of space. If this still dont give enough clearance (my gt42 for instance) the connectors on the abs can be cut back & the wires soldered direct to the pins on the pump it will give a further 1.5" clearance. With heatshrink sleeving it can be made to look good etc.
